pfc_tran()
Returns frequency-selective power
Syntax
y = pfc_tran(vPlus, vMinus, iOut, fundFreq, harmNum)
Arguments
| Name | Description | Range | Type | Required |
|---|---|---|---|---|
| vPlus | voltage at the positive terminal | (-∞, ∞) | real, complex | yes |
| vMinus | voltage at the negative terminal | (-∞, ∞) | real, complex | yes |
| iOut | current through a branch measured for power calculation | (-∞, ∞) | real, complex | yes |
| fundFreq | fundamental frequency | [0, ∞) | real | yes |
| harmNum | harmonic number of the fundamental frequency | [0, ∞) | integer | yes |
Examples
a = pfc_tran(v1, v2, I_Probe1.i, 1GHz, 1)
Defined in
$HPEESOF_DIR/expressions/ael/circuit_fun.ael
See Also
Notes/Equations
This measurement gives RMS power, delivered to any part of the circuit at a particular frequency of interest. fundFreq determines the portion of the time-domain waveform to be converted to frequency domain. This is typically one full period corresponding to the lowest frequency in the waveform. harmNum is the harmonic number of the fundamental frequency at which the power is requested.
